What was your favorite thing you learned about?
I love using the digital camera and posting photos, and especially liked using Picnik to add a frame and text to my flower picture. Exploring Flickr was fun and I found some interesting blogs through Bloglines. I can see myself using Library Thing in the future as well as wikis and ListenNJ. YouTube is of course fun and I am now interested in podcasts as well.

Conversely, what did you like least about Web 2.0?
Even though I was exposed to more sites of interest because of Bloglines, I think RSS feeds might be my least favorite thing about Web 2.0. I'm just not sold on it.

What areas of Web 2.0 do you think the library should get more involved in?
I know they have already started using it, but I think using YouTube as a way to advertise and expose library programs is something OCL could get more involved in. YouTube is really popular so we could reach a lot of people that way.

What Web 2.0 services have you shared with your friends and family?
I am going to share about ListenNJ with friends and family because I don't think many people know about this.
